Compact Tri Band Frequency Reconfigurable L-Slot Octagonal Shape Patch Antenna

Abstract: A frequency reconfigurable octagonal shaped patch antenna is designed and its properties are studied. In this paper, a microstrip patch antenna. In this antenna design patch of the antenna is separated into three parts by cutting the open ended L-slot on the both side of the patch. Here four PIN diodes are used for the operation. When the diode D 1 and D 3 is on than the antenna works on the frequency 4.6688 GHz, 7.8864 GHz and 10.662 GHz while the D 2 and D 4 is on state than this antenna works for the 5.1893… Show more
